VEA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2014 in Review

476 of the 3,447 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F (VEA) for Q3 2014, worth a combined $14.8B — down 2% from $15.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 37 funds opened new VEA positions and 24 closed out — a net gain of 13 holders — while 239 added to existing stakes and 112 trimmed.

The largest buyer was M&T Bank, adding an estimated $425M. The largest seller was City National Bank, cutting an estimated $71M.
